On this date in 1974 Bob Dylan had his first ever #1 album with Planet Waves.

Wait. What?

Yes. Believe it or not, Planet Waves, a Dylan collaboration with The Band, was his first #1 album.

The odd thing - Planet Waves was Dylan's first #1 LP.

The odder thing - today this is kind of a lost Dylan record as far as popularity goes.

The oddest odd thing - Planet Waves is a great record and deserving of a #1 spot even though lots of folks are oblivious to it's existence.
